Concerns about Set(o) form questions -- Please help!!!

Post by ablushali » Mon Jun 03, 2013 3:08 pm

I am going to apply for my ILR next month (i.e. July 2013). I have bit long immigration history, which is given below

1. First entered in the UK in October 2002 on Student VISA

2. Switched to Work Permit in May 2006, (out country switching)

3. Left UK end of July 2007

4. Came back to UK on 4th August 2008 (new work permit)

5. Switched to Tier1(G) in May 2009

I am going to apply for ILR, second week of next month, based on WP + Tier1

I have few confusions about the following questions of Set(O) form,

[b]6.1 When did you (the main applicant) first enter the UK?[/b]

==> I believe this is straight forward, 4th August 2008

Now the confusing part for me is the question 7.11, i.e.

[b]7.11. How long have you lived in the UK?
Please provide details of any periods of absence of more than 6 months during that time.[/b]

==> What should I put here, 9 years 9 months or 4 years 11 months.


I would appreciate if some one could provide me with some expert advice.

Post by dubeyv » Mon Jun 03, 2013 3:36 pm

4 years 11 months..

Post by ablushali » Tue Jun 04, 2013 12:07 pm

Thanks dubeyv for your response. But r u sure that the question 7.11 refers only to the ILR eligibility period and not the entire immigration history.

Any suggestion from others?

dubeyv
Newly Registered
Posts: 25
Joined: Mon Mar 25, 2013 11:43 am

Post by dubeyv » Tue Jun 04, 2013 12:25 pm

I am dead sure about this as your immigration history would only count when you are applying under 10 years long history.. on that day if you are using SET O form all they would be interested in is either date of entry in Uk or Visa date by which you are eligible to apply for ILR... the more you explain.. the more they get confused and more the delay and more the search.. so keep it simple and straight.... Dont leave any open ended questions if you understand what I mean.. :)
